Rembrandt - Bathsheba at her Bath [1654]

A depiction that is both sensual and empathetic, this painting shows a moment from the Old Testament story in which King David sees Bathsheba bathing and, entranced, seduces and impregnates her. In order to marry Bathsheba and conceal his sin, David sends her husband into battle and orders his generals to abandon him, leaving him to certain death. While the scene of David spying on Bathsheba had been painted by earlier artists, Rembrandt's depiction differs in its tight pictorial focus and erotic vitality, achieved through broad, thick brushstrokes and vibrant colouration.

[Musée du Louvre, Paris - Oil on canvas, 142 x 142 cm]
